I tried ACE inhibitors, beta-blockers, and calcium channel blockers to try to control my BP. They worked but I did not tolerate the side effects. I tried hydrochlorothiazide w/o side effects but little effect on my BP. Switched to chlorthalidone and my BP came down and no side effects. It’s cheap too. Fortunately I do not have chronic kidney disease and because my BP is now under control I won’t.
